> Besides the experimental flow jobs, and the manual OST job, we also have a 
> few more jobs that run specific OST suits on a scheduled basis.
> Historically theses suits were written by different people and different job 
> templates in YAML were also written for each suit.
> At some point we have normalized all the suit names in OST to be of the 
> following structure:
> {code}
> <suit_type>-suit-<ovirt version>
> {code}
> This was initially done to allow the mirror injection process to find the 
> '{{reposync-config.repo}}' file but also facilitated the creation of the 
> generic manual OST job.
> Since all suites now follow the same naming convention there is no more 
> reason to have separate YAML job templates per suit. This separation may even 
> cause subtle issues.
> All the YAML OST job templates should be unified so that we'll have just one 
> job template that is parametrized by the suite type and oVirt version. 
> Furthermore we can probably have just one YAML project entry to create all 
> scheduled OST jobs.
